HP's touchscreen family PC heads to the kitchen

touchsmart.jpgHP has a new touchscreen computer in the works called the TouchSmart IQ770. Designed to sit in your kitchen or another common space and act as kind of a central hub for your family, it's a unique type of PC that's designed to be used sans keyboard (even though it does come with a wireless keyboard and mouse).

The TouchSmart is not designed to be a replacement for your standard PC, but is basically a souped-up calendar, message board, and DVD player. Still, it's a really nicely designed computer that I could definitely see being a family's email station and central organizer, allowing everyone to easy access the Internet and basic applications quickly and easily. No word on pricing or availability, but we'll keep our eyes peeled for more info on this as it comes out.
